A bill aimed at making Louisiana more enticing to the wood pellet industry has sailed through the state legislature.

House Bill 670 won unanimous approval in the Louisiana House and Senate. It would ease regulations for pellet manufacturers while directing state support toward workforce development, financial incentives and infrastructure improvements designed to meet the industry’s needs.
